Understanding Nonconformance in the Manufacturing Industry

Nonconformance in the manufacturing industry refers to deviations from established processes, specifications, or regulatory requirements that compromise product quality, safety, or compliance. Examples include material defects, equipment malfunctions, or procedural lapses. Addressing nonconformance is critical to maintaining operational integrity, ensuring customer satisfaction, and minimizing regulatory and financial risks.

The Strategic Importance of Managing Nonconformance in Manufacturing Industy

Effectively addressing nonconformance is essential for maintaining high standards in manufacturing and achieving long-term success.

  • Upholding Product Quality Standards

    Resolving nonconformities promptly ensures that manufactured products consistently meet predefined quality specifications and customer expectations.

  • Avoiding Production Delays

    Timely identification and resolution of issues prevent bottlenecks in operations, ensuring schedules are met and disruptions minimized.

  • Optimizing Cost Efficiency

    Addressing nonconformance early reduces the financial impact associated with rework, scrap, recalls, or penalties.

  • Ensuring Regulatory Adherence

    Proactively managing deviations ensures compliance with industry regulations and standards, mitigating the risk of penalties or operational shutdowns.

  • Safeguarding Brand Reputation

    Demonstrating a robust commitment to quality reinforces trust among stakeholders and protects the brand from reputational damage due to defective products.

Key Challenges of Nonconformance Management in Manufacturing and CQ Solutions

1. Difficulty in Identifying Nonconformities Across Complex Operations

  • Challenge: In large-scale manufacturing, pinpointing nonconformities across multiple stages and facilities can be time-consuming and prone to oversight.
  • CQ Solution: Implement advanced nonconformance software with real-time monitoring and automated alerts to identify and address deviations promptly.

2. Inefficient Root Cause Analysis

  • Challenge: Identifying the root cause of nonconformities can be challenging due to the complexity of manufacturing processes and interdependencies.
  • CQ Solution: Use software with built-in root cause analysis tools that leverage data analytics to quickly uncover and address underlying issues.

3. Managing Data Silos and Fragmentation

  • Challenge: Data stored in disconnected systems leads to incomplete visibility and delays in addressing nonconformance issues.
  • CQ Solution: Integrate a centralized platform that consolidates data from various departments, ensuring seamless access and improved collaboration.

4. Regulatory Compliance Pressure

  • Challenge: Constantly evolving regulations require manufacturers to update processes and documentation, making compliance a moving target.
  • CQ Solution: Utilize compliance-focused nonconformance software that keeps up with regulatory changes and automates compliance tracking and reporting.

5. Resistance to Change and Adoption of Technology

  • Challenge: Employees may resist new systems due to a lack of familiarity, leading to underutilization of nonconformance management tools.
  • CQ Solution: Choose user-friendly software and provide comprehensive training and change management programs to ensure smooth adoption.

6. Delayed Communication Between Departments

  • Challenge: Poor communication between departments can lead to delays in resolving nonconformance issues and implementing corrective actions.
  • CQ Solution: Implement software with centralized communication features, enabling real-time updates and collaboration across teams to expedite resolutions.

By addressing these challenges with robust CQ solutions, manufacturers can improve efficiency, reduce risks, and maintain high standards of quality and compliance.

Key Considerations When Selecting Nonconformance Management Software System for Manufacturing

Scalability for Future Growth

Select software that can grow with your organization, accommodating increased production volumes, new facilities, and expanding regulatory requirements.

Real-Time Monitoring and Reporting

Look for systems that offer real-time tracking and detailed reporting to enable proactive management of nonconformities.

Customization to Fit Unique Processes

Choose a solution that allows flexibility to adapt to your specific workflows, production methodologies, and compliance needs.

Integration with Existing Systems

Ensure the software seamlessly integrates with your current tools such as ERP, QMS, or MES systems, enabling unified data flow and process optimization.

User-Friendly Interface

Opt for software that is intuitive and easy to use to minimize training time and encourage adoption across teams at all levels.

Comprehensive Compliance Features

The software should include tools to track and document compliance with industry standards and regulations, simplifying audits and inspections.

Mobile Accessibility

Choose software with mobile-friendly features to allow on-the-go reporting and resolution directly from the production floor.

Robust Analytics and Insights

Ensure the platform offers advanced analytics capabilities, providing actionable insights for continuous process improvement.

Vendor Support and Reliability

Partner with a reliable vendor offering strong technical support, regular updates, and training to ensure long-term success.

Cost-Effectiveness

Evaluate the total cost of ownership, ensuring the software delivers measurable ROI through improved efficiency, reduced risks, and better compliance.

By considering these factors, manufacturers can choose a nonconformance software solution that enhances quality management, streamlines operations and supports long-term organizational goals.
